In comparing SGV football and SGV waterpolo, the level of talent and skill in the SGV is much greater in waterpolo. Whereas football coaches across teh country look to LB Poly, Loyola, Oaks Christian, etc. for top tier talent year in and year out, water polo coaches look to La Canada, South Pasadena, St. Francis, Crescenta Valley, and recently Temple City to fill their Div. 1 coffers. Speaking with limited knowledge of the development of the SM and TC programs, I know that LC and SP alumni have trained and played with the olympic team, set NCAA records at the highest level, played and starred at college programs such as USC, UCLA, Pepperdine, UCSD, UC Berkeley, Stanford, US Naval Academy, US Air Force Academy, UC Santa Cruz, CSULB, University of Tennessee, and many others. Each year the SGV produces numerous All Americans and all-CIF players. From the team perspective, a telling fact about the quality of SGV water polo is that a legitimate goal of teams like LC, SP, TC, and others is a CIF championship. This is their goal year in and year out. This is not the same in football (especially before the CIF realignment). Water polo is a SGV sport that does not get the attention or recognition from the general public it deserves in relation to the respect it receives by the highest levels of the sport.
A foul in water polo is generally any action that causes excessive contact with an opposing player, as long as that player is not in direct possession of the ball, thereby impeding the offensive player from freedom of movement. There are certain categories of fouls, much like in hockey, which result in a 20 second ejection and a "power play," referred to as a "6 on 5" situation. Generally these fouls are committed by impeding the forward progress of an offensive player from behind (ex. dunking him and kicking him from behind as he swims for the ball)

As for a dominant SGV water polo program the last ten years or so, La Canada stands pretty far above the rest. After La Canada, I would say South Pas has maintained a strong program, despite a few down years here and there. So Pas and former coach Jerry Wolf had a tremendous run in the 1990's (similar to the Larry Naeve teams of the 2000's, but a different style) TC has just recently begun to come on as a perennial contender in the RHL and CIF. The big difference between these programs and the other SGV teams is STRONG club participation for teams like Rose Bowl Aquatics that consistently employ the best coaches in the country. SP and LC have for years looked to the Mecca of waterpolo, Orange Co., for their off season tournaments. They compete and win against the best teams in the country and year in and year out produce all-americans and successful Div. 1 athletes. I would venture to say that, along with girls soccer, the SGV produces more Div. 1 water polo talent than any other high school sport.
